了解laravel_session是什么

  今天我们将介绍laravel_session的含义、作用以及相关知识,帮助读者深入了解laravel框架中的session管理。

什么是laravel_session

  laravel_session指的是Laravel框架中用于管理用户会话状态的一种机制。它主要用于存储用户的身份验证信息以及其他重要数据,确保用户在访问网站时能够保持持久的登录状态。

  laravel_session的工作原理

  在Laravel中,当用户首次登录或者进行身份验证后,系统会为用户分配一个唯一的session ID,并将相关的信息存储在服务器端的session存储器中,同时将session ID 发送给用户端。用户在后续的访问中会携带该session ID,以实现持久的登录状态。

  session管理的安全性

  Laravel框架通过加密和签名等手段确保了session数据的安全性,有效防止了会话劫持和篡改等安全威胁。

laravel_session的配置与优化

  为了确保laravel_session的高效运行,我们可以进行一些配置和优化。这不仅能够提升应用性能,还可以增强用户体验。

  laravel_session的配置参数

  在Laravel中,我们可以通过配置文件对laravel_session进行参数设置,包括session存储驱动、生命周期、前缀等。这些参数的调整可以根据具体需求进行灵活配置。

  laravel_session的性能优化

  为了提升laravel_session的性能,我们可以考虑使用缓存等手段,减轻数据库压力,并通过合理配置session生命周期等方式,优化用户体验。

总结

  通过本文的介绍,相信读者对laravel_session有了更深入的了解。它作为Laravel框架中重要的一环,不仅能帮助我们实现用户会话管理,还能为应用的安全性和性能提供有力保障。在实际开发中,合理地使用和配置laravel_session将对应用的稳定性和用户体验产生积极影响。

原创声明:文章来自技象科技,如欲转载,请注明本文链接: //www.viralrail.com/blog/73412.html

免费咨询组网方案
Baidu
map